legongju.com
我们一直在努力
2024-12-27 12:10 | 星期五

php ziparchive适合何种需求

PHP ZipArchive 类非常适合处理文件压缩和解压缩的需求。以下是一些典型的使用场景:

  1. 文件归档:当你需要将多个文件或文件夹打包成一个单独的文件(如 .zip 文件)以便于存储、传输或共享时,可以使用 ZipArchive 类。

  2. 数据备份:在进行数据备份时,可以使用 ZipArchive 类将数据库、配置文件、日志等文件压缩成一个备份文件,以便于存储或传输。

  3. 文件上传处理:在处理用户上传的文件时,可以使用 ZipArchive 类对上传的文件进行解压、验证和处理。

  4. 文件下载处理:在处理用户下载的文件时,可以使用 ZipArchive 类对下载的文件进行打包、加密或添加额外的安全措施。

  5. 权限管理:可以使用 ZipArchive 类对文件或文件夹设置不同的压缩级别和权限,以便于实现细粒度的访问控制。

  6. 文件同步:在同步多个服务器上的文件时,可以使用 ZipArchive 类将文件打包成一个压缩包,以便于传输和存储。

总之,PHP ZipArchive 类适用于需要处理文件压缩和解压缩的各种场景。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/5133.html

相关推荐

  • php数组urlencode如何实现

    php数组urlencode如何实现

    ?PHP?,????urlencode()?????????????URL????????????: ????????????:
    Array
    ( [0] => value1 [1] => value+with+spaces [2] => value/with/slashes

  • php的超全局变量有哪些用途

    php的超全局变量有哪些用途

    PHP的超全局变量主要有以下几种用途: 访问请求信息:超全局变量如$_SERVER可以存储有关头、路径和脚本位置等请求信息。这使得开发人员能够轻松地获取并操作这些...

  • PHP PostgreSQL能否支持多种数据类型

    PHP PostgreSQL能否支持多种数据类型

    是的,PHP PostgreSQL 支持多种数据类型。当您在使用 PHP 的 pg_connect 函数连接到 PostgreSQL 数据库时,您可以使用各种数据类型来存储和操作数据。以下是一些...

  • PHP PostgreSQL怎样优化存储结构

    PHP PostgreSQL怎样优化存储结构

    要优化PHP和PostgreSQL的存储结构,可以遵循以下建议: 选择合适的数据类型:为每个字段选择最合适的数据类型,以减少存储空间和提高查询效率。例如,使用INT而不...

  • python astype如何处理缺失值

    python astype如何处理缺失值

    在Python中,astype()函数用于将一个NumPy数组或 Pandas Series/DataFrame的元素类型转换为另一个类型
    对于Pandas DataFrame,你可以使用fillna()方法来处理...

  • python astype与其他方法的区别

    python astype与其他方法的区别

    astype() 是 pandas 库中 DataFrame 和 Series 对象的一个方法,用于将数据类型转换为指定的类型 astype() 是 pandas 库中的方法,而其他方法可能来自不同的库。...

  • python astype能处理复杂数据吗

    python astype能处理复杂数据吗

    astype() 是 Pandas 库中 DataFrame 和 Series 对象的一个方法,用于将数据类型转换为指定的类型。它可以处理各种基本数据类型,如整数、浮点数、字符串等。对于...

  • python astype适用于哪些场景

    python astype适用于哪些场景

    astype() 是 Pandas 库中 DataFrame 和 Series 对象的一个方法,它用于将数据类型转换为指定的类型。以下是一些使用 astype() 的常见场景: 数据清洗:在数据分析...